ESSCI Highlights India’s Electronics Skilling Expertise at India Soft & India Electronics Expo 2025

New Delhi – The Electronics Sector Skills Council of India (ESSCI) successfully participated in the 25th edition of India Soft & India Electronics Expo 2025, held at Bharat Mandapam, New Delhi. The event brought together over 1,500 Indian exhibitors and 400 international delegates from more than 80 countries, reinforcing India’s position as a global technology hub.

ESSCI’s presence at the expo underscored its commitment to advancing electronics skill development and fostering industry collaborations. The organization showcased its initiatives in Electronics System Design and Manufacturing (ESDM), upskilling programs, and industry partnerships. By aligning with global standards and driving innovation, ESSCI continues to play a vital role in shaping the future of the electronics workforce in India.

Exhibitions like India Soft & India Electronics Expo play a crucial role in fostering industry growth by providing a platform for knowledge exchange, business networking, and collaboration between key stakeholders. The Indian government has been actively promoting such events to drive innovation, attract foreign investment, and enhance the country’s electronics manufacturing ecosystem. Through initiatives like ‘Make in India’ and ‘Digital India,’ the government aims to position India as a global hub for electronics and technology, with skill development playing a key role in this transformation.

Reflecting on the success of the event, Mr. Saleem Ahmed, Officiating Head of ESSCI, stated, “Our participation in IndiaSoft & India Electronics Expo 2025 has been a remarkable opportunity to showcase our initiatives and connect with global stakeholders. We are dedicated to empowering the next generation of skilled professionals and driving innovation in the electronics sector.”

The ESSCI exhibit attracted a significant number of visitors, including industry leaders, academicians, and aspiring professionals. Engaging discussions, interactive sessions, and live demonstrations provided attendees with insights into the latest trends and opportunities in the electronics sector. The total footfall at ESSCI’s stall was over 500, highlighting the high level of interest and engagement from the attendees.

ESSCI’s active involvement in IndiaSoft & India Electronics Expo 2025 reinforces its pivotal role in the development of skilled manpower for the Indian electronics industry. The organization remains steadfast in its mission to foster innovation, enhance skill sets, and build robust industry collaborations, propelling the sector to new heights.
